How long should I study the Bible each day?
The Bible never specifies a time for reading the Scriptures. But the Bible does tell us to let the Word of Christ dwell in us richly (Colossians 3:16). To do this, we recommend reading the Bible daily for at least 20 minutes to an hour.

How can I study my Bible by myself?
Soap. Bible Study Bible: write verses in your journal. Observations: Write down observations about the Bible. Application: How can you apply what you have observed in your life? Prayer: Write a prayer to God based on what you have learned, asking Him to give you the opportunity to live this truth.

What is it called when you preach the word of God?
Expository preaching, also called expositional preaching, is a form of preaching that recounts the meaning of a particular text or biblical passage. It explains what the Bible means by what it says …
